This year Cedar Wood Elementary has started a new program called the Natural Leaders, a family engagement program from the Washington Alliance for Better Schools (WABS). Natural Leaders is a group of multi-cultural parents and families who work to build strong connections among families and our school, and support the success of all students. It is a program that is led by parents and families in coordination with Cedar Wood staff to:
- Build relationships with families
- Listen to families’ ideas on how to help their children be successful in school
- Bring families and schools together to plan/implement the families’ ideas
